1. Information Overwriting

Information overwriting represents a big obstacle to profitable information retrieval on Android gadgets after a manufacturing unit reset. The manufacturing unit reset process, whereas designed to revive the system to its authentic state, additionally initiates a course of that may compromise the integrity of beforehand saved information, affecting the viability of subsequent restoration makes an attempt. Understanding the mechanics of knowledge overwriting is essential for assessing the feasibility of retrieving data.

  • The Mechanism of Information Overwriting

    Following a manufacturing unit reset, the system’s storage is usually not completely cleared within the sense that the outdated information is bodily eliminated. As a substitute, the areas occupied by the previous information are marked as out there for brand spanking new information. Subsequent use of the system might then end in new data being written to those places, successfully changing the outdated information with new information. This overwriting motion renders the unique information more and more tough, and doubtlessly not possible, to get well.

  • Influence on Information Restoration Software program

    Information restoration software program depends on figuring out and reconstructing fragments of knowledge that stay within the system’s reminiscence after deletion or formatting. Nonetheless, if these fragments have been overwritten by new information, the software program might be unable to reconstruct the unique information. The effectiveness of knowledge restoration instruments diminishes proportionally to the extent of the overwriting that has occurred.

  • The Function of Time and Utilization

    The longer the interval between the manufacturing unit reset and the try and get well information, the higher the chance that information overwriting has taken place. Equally, elevated utilization of the system after the reset, corresponding to putting in purposes, taking pictures, or downloading information, will improve the possibilities of information being overwritten. Immediate motion to provoke information restoration is subsequently important to attenuate the danger of irreversible information loss.

  • Information Carving Methods

    Superior information restoration methods, corresponding to information carving, try and establish and extract particular file varieties based mostly on their recognized headers and footers, even when the file system metadata has been broken or overwritten. Nonetheless, even these strategies are weak to the consequences of knowledge overwriting. If the information inside the file itself has been overwritten, information carving might be unable to reconstruct the entire and correct file.

In abstract, the interaction between information overwriting and information retrieval efforts is a important consideration. The extra information that’s overwritten following a manufacturing unit reset, the decrease the chance of profitable restoration. Due to this fact, minimizing system utilization post-reset and promptly initiating information restoration procedures are key elements in maximizing the possibilities of retrieving beneficial data.

2. Encryption Influence

Gadget encryption introduces a big layer of complexity to information retrieval efforts following a manufacturing unit reset. In Android gadgets, encryption scrambles information, rendering it unintelligible with out the right decryption key. A manufacturing unit reset, designed to erase consumer information, typically features a step that deletes this key. Consequently, even when information restoration software program can find remnants of information, these remnants are prone to be encrypted, making them unusable with out the unique decryption key. The usage of full-disk encryption, commonplace on fashionable Android gadgets, amplifies this impact, as the complete storage quantity is topic to this safety.

The affect of encryption necessitates that any information restoration try should first tackle the decryption barrier. If the decryption key has been securely erased through the manufacturing unit reset, typical information restoration strategies are usually ineffective. Superior methods, corresponding to forensic information restoration, might try and reconstruct the important thing itself, however these are complicated, pricey, and never at all times profitable. The potential for fulfillment relies upon closely on the precise encryption algorithm used, the system producer’s implementation, and whether or not any remnants of the important thing exist in unallocated storage. Contemplate a state of affairs the place a enterprise government’s cellphone undergoes a manufacturing unit reset; delicate shopper information, beforehand protected by system encryption, turns into irretrievable if the decryption key’s misplaced.

In abstract, encryption poses a considerable impediment to information restoration after a manufacturing unit reset. Whereas information restoration instruments may establish encrypted file fragments, the absence of the decryption key renders these fragments unusable. Customers should pay attention to this constraint and prioritize proactive information backup methods to mitigate the danger of everlasting information loss. The interplay between encryption and manufacturing unit resets highlights the important significance of understanding information safety protocols and their implications for information recoverability.

8. File System

The file system is a elementary factor dictating the construction and group of knowledge on an Android system. Its traits immediately affect the complexity and potential success of knowledge restoration efforts following a manufacturing unit reset. Understanding the file system in use is subsequently essential when making an attempt to retrieve misplaced information.

  • Journaling and Metadata

    Journaling file programs, corresponding to ext4 generally utilized in Android, keep a file of modifications earlier than they’re written to the primary file system. This journal might be invaluable throughout information restoration, offering a way to reconstruct file system metadata broken throughout a manufacturing unit reset. For instance, if the file system metadata is corrupted, the journal can be utilized to revive file names, sizes, and places, considerably bettering the possibilities of profitable restoration. The absence of journaling, conversely, will increase the reliance on uncooked information carving methods, that are inherently much less exact.

  • Information Storage Strategies

    Completely different file programs make use of various information storage strategies. Some file programs allocate contiguous blocks of storage for information, whereas others permit information to be fragmented throughout non-contiguous blocks. File fragmentation complicates information restoration efforts, because it requires piecing collectively a number of non-contiguous fragments to reconstruct an entire file. The diploma of fragmentation following a manufacturing unit reset influences the effectiveness of knowledge restoration instruments in precisely reassembling misplaced information. Understanding the storage methodology utilized by the precise file system is thus important for optimizing information restoration methods.

  • Encryption and Entry Controls

    The file system additionally governs encryption and entry management mechanisms. Android gadgets typically implement file-based encryption, which encrypts particular person information or directories relatively than the complete storage quantity. Manufacturing unit resets usually take away the decryption keys, rendering encrypted information inaccessible. Whereas information restoration instruments might establish encrypted information, recovering the unique information requires circumventing the encryption, which is usually infeasible with out the unique decryption key or vital computational sources. The interplay between file system-level encryption and information restoration efforts highlights the necessity for specialised methods and instruments.

  • File System Kind and Instrument Compatibility

    Android gadgets make the most of varied file programs, together with ext4, F2FS, and others. The selection of file system impacts the compatibility and effectiveness of knowledge restoration instruments. Some instruments are particularly designed to work with sure file programs, whereas others supply broader compatibility. Utilizing a software that’s not optimized for the precise file system in use may end up in incomplete or inaccurate information restoration. Due to this fact, choosing a restoration software that’s tailor-made to the file system employed by the Android system is essential for maximizing the possibilities of a profitable consequence.

In conclusion, the file system is a pivotal issue governing the success of knowledge restoration after a manufacturing unit reset. Its journaling capabilities, information storage strategies, encryption options, and the compatibility of restoration instruments all contribute to the complexity of the restoration course of. A complete understanding of the file system in use is subsequently important for growing and executing efficient information restoration methods, serving to to get well information android after manufacturing unit reset.
